Hi, I have not done anything with this before, so outside of the basic marquee tag (or whatever it should be called :) ) I am lost.
However, what I would like to do is to have a basic file (*.txt perhaps) that a marquee would use for its content.
This is so a non-PC literate person can put a message (on our intranet webpage) without having to delve into HTML.
Is there a way of doing this?
